The MKC is widely regaled as the first true Lincoln of the modern era. As part of the new direction of the company after rebranding several years ago, this car received its very own independent development team who have created the purest expression of Lincoln’s new design philosophy. This ideal starts with what we consider the best implementation yet of the split-wing grille which forms a visual unit with the headlights and signature LED accents. The large wheels and sculpted lines make the biggest visual impact on the sides, but the MKC’s best feature is its rear. The clamshell door is hydroformed from one piece of steel and allows for uninterrupted LED taillights.

Under the hood, the MKC brings youthful vigor to a venerated brand. With two EcoBoost engines to choose from, the 2.3L twin-turbocharged four-cylinder engine is a variant of the one found in the 2015 Ford Mustang. It comes paired with a six-speed SelectShift automatic transmission and equipped with paddle shifters and a Sport mode for when you really want to let loose.

Inside is your reminder that Lincoln is the pinnacle of American luxury. Thanks to the all-new Bridge of Weir Deepsoft leather, these are the most comfortable seats you’ll ever sit in. Also, the MKC team has triumphed with the first Lincoln steering wheel, a Wollsdorf leather-wrapped, Euro-stitched home for your hands that puts you in total control.
